UKstages Posted March 23 #7 Share Posted March 23 the agent wasn't being difficult. they have no insight into the price, in the same way that guests don't. my understanding is that the thermal suite pricing is dynamic and depends on a number of factors, including the number of days, ship, itinerary and the season. the pricing only becomes available once the reservation is booked, and only if you are 365 days or fewer from the sail date. if the vibe pricing is an indicator, passes tend to max out at ten days. so, a ten or fourteen day cruise would be the same price. i can't provide a price, though. buddy1755 Posted March 24 #8 Share Posted March 24 (edited) Thermal suite $379 for P/P for 14 day transatlantic on the Getaway April 29th 2024 Edited March 24 by buddy1755 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
buddy1755 Posted March 24 #9 Share Posted March 24 (edited) Upgrade to Unlimited Wi-Fi Stay connected by upgrading your Free At Sea package to Unlimited Wi-Fi. Includes access to general browsing, emails, and messaging. PRICE $204.86 Upgrade to Unlimited Premium Wi-Fi Stay connected by upgrading your Free At Sea package to Unlimited Premium Wi-Fi. Includes streaming for movies, podcasts, and more. PRICE $344.86 per person Edited March 24 by buddy1755 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
